Global gene expression analysis data of chicken dendritic cells infected with H9N2 avian influenza virus.


Liu Q[SUP]1[/SUP], Yang J[SUP]1[/SUP], Huang X[SUP]1[/SUP], Liu Y[SUP]1[/SUP], Han K[SUP]1[/SUP], Zhao D[SUP]1[/SUP], Zhang L[SUP]1[/SUP], Li Y[SUP]1[/SUP].

Author information




Abstract

This data article reports the global gene expression analysis data of chicken DCs infected with H9N2 avian influenza virus (AIV) compared with mock infection. The differentially expressed genes (DEGs), and the data of GO enrichment analysis and KEGG pathway analysis for DEGs were reported here. In addition, some of these DEGs associated with innate immune response and antigen presentation were also verified by qPCR. The replication of H9N2 AIV in DCs, and the viability kinetic of DCs during H9N2 AIV infection, and the primers for qPCR were also reported in this data article. The data presented here was used on the research article entitled "Transcriptomic profile of chicken bone marrow-derive dendritic cells in response to H9N2 avianinfluenza A virus".
